Transaction 38e588196bd13f3e282541fd07a01ce6af0fb70ff84bfad0d72dccd0dd146ceb
1 Input
1 Output
-
38e588196bd13f3e282541fd07a01ce6af0fb70ff84bfad0d72dccd0dd146ceb:0
- value
- 770310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 17385d9d892021b701b6493cc7ebedfffd74dd50 OP_EQUALVERIFY OP_CHECKSIG
- address
- 137n4maRQ7bLWC5FyvQCvApNGfeuL7256e